> > The other known issue with svn trunk involves the Highlighter, which doesn't
> > always select the proper excerpt. That wouldn't affect the dev release on
> > CPAN, though.
>
> This issue would be less problematic if this occurs only sometimes.
It's frequent enough to be unacceptable: 1 in 20, 1 in 30. What happens is
that when the Highlighter trims an excerpt, the keyword that made the excerpt
relevant gets trimmed sometimes, yielding an excerpt that is not obviously
relevant.
In the grand scheme of things, it's probably not that hard to solve, but I've
been focused elsewhere.
